Roscoe (14yr) and his 10-year-old sweetheart Sheila are the definition of a perfect pair. These adorable terrier companions have been together and must be adopted as a duo, and once you meet them, you’ll understand why — their bond is truly special.
 
Despite being seniors, they still have plenty of love to give and life to enjoy! Both are spunky in their own sweet way and love the simple pleasures in life. You’ll often find them happily rolling on their backs in the grass, soaking up the sunshine, or enjoying quiet walks together.
 
They’re gentle companions who prefer peace over chaos — not the type to wrestle over toys or have little spats. Sheila absolutely adores attention, and Roscoe is always close by to make sure he gets his fair share too!
 
Roscoe is on a prescription kidney-support diet as a preventative due to his age, and he happily cleans his bowl every time. These two would thrive in a quiet, laid-back home where they can relax, enjoy time with their family, and continue spending their days side-by-side.
